Armani presented its popular masculine aquatic fragrance Acqua di Gio in 1996. Nearly 20 years later, a new version of the fragrance is launched - Acqua Di Gio Profumo, elegant, airy and deep. The fragrance symbolizes the merging of sea waves with black rocks. The nose behind this fragrance is Alberto Morillas.
Top Notes: Sea Notes and Bergamot;
Heart Notes : Rosemary, Sage and Geranium;
Base notes : Incense and Patchouli.
